Equine Emergency Industry Scan Survey

If an emergency or disaster was to happen, do you know how to protect your horses? 

This survey is intended to identify areas of need, to assist horse owners and custodians to prepare for an emergency or disaster. The data collected from this survey will be used to develop an emergency and disaster preparedness plan for the equine industry and guidelines for Alberta horse owners and custodians.

Response regarding reports of nEHV-1 - Message from Alberta Agriculture and Forestry

On October 18, 2016 a letter was sent to all veterinarians through the A.B.V.M.A. (Alberta Veterinary Medical Association) regarding recent phone calls that had been received from horse owners who had heard that there may be a case of neurotropic equine herpes virus (nEHV-1) at a stable in Alberta.
 
Farmers to benefit from expansion of efficiency grants


Additional support is being provided through the industry-supported Climate Change Emissions Management Fund. The funding will support the expansion of the following programs:
  • On-Farm Energy Management Program Increase the percentage of capital purchases covered to 70 per cent from the current 35 per cent and increase the cap on funding to $750,000 (up from $50,000)
  • On-Farm Solar PV Program
  • Irrigation Efficiency Program
  • Accelerating Agricultural Innovation Program

Did you Know... 

One of the common questions asked by members is "What if my horse dies?"

Members Named Perils (MNP) is an optional insurance you can add to your membership for the low cost of $22.00.  It insures any horse(s) you own in case of death resulting from fire, lightning, collision/overturn of a conveyance in which your horse is being transported, attack by dog or wild animal, windstorm, drowning, collapse of building, and more. Maximum benefit payable for any one year, for any one member is $10,000.  Losses restricted to one claim per year.

MNP can be added to an existing membership. Simply log in and select "Add Insurance to Existing Alberta Equestrian Federation Membership" or call 1-877-463-6233 or 403-253-4411. We would be happy to help you!
